Chicken Kiev Recipe
  • Prep: 20 min. + freezing Bake: 35 min.
  • Yield: 6 Servings
20 35 55

Ingredients

  • 1/4 cup butter, softened
  • 1 tablespoon grated onion
  • 1 tablespoon chopped fresh parsley
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on dried tarragon
  • 1/4 teaspoon pepper
  • 6 boneless skinless chicken breast halves
  • 1 egg
  • 1 tablespoon milk
  • 1 envelope (2-3/4 ounces) seasoned chicken coating mix

Directions

  • Combine the butter, onion, parsley, garlic powder, tarragon and pepper. Shape mixture into six pencil-thin strips about 2 in. long; place on waxed paper. Freeze until firm, about 30 minutes. Flatten each chicken breast to 1/4 in. Place one butter strip in the center of each chicken breast. Fold long sides over butter; fold ends up and secure with a toothpick. In a bowl, beat egg and milk; place coating mix in another bowl. Dip chicken, then roll in coating mix. Place chicken, seam side down, in a greased 13-in. x 9-in. baking pan. Bake, uncovered, at 425° or until the chicken is no longer pink and the juices run clear. Remove toothpicks before serving. Microwave Directions (timing based on a 1100-watt oven): Place chicken in a greased glass pie plate. Microwave on high for 2-1/2 minutes. Turn plate; microwave for 1-2 minutes or until juices run clear. Let stand 5 minutes. Yield: 6 servings.

Editor's Note: This recipe was tested in a 1,100-watt microwave.

Recipes with Base Mix: Versatile Coating Mix

Nutritional Facts 1 serving (1 each) equals 252 calories, 14 g fat (7 g saturated fat), 119 mg cholesterol, 464 mg sodium, 7 g carbohydrate, trace fiber, 24 g protein.
